    Just follow the steps below: Enter your age. Measure your resting heart rate. It's best to check it in the morning, just after waking up, but before getting out of bed. Put your fingers over your pulse - the best places to measure it are on your wrist on the thumb side, the inside of your elbow, and on the side of your neck.
